What are Frontend Developers?

Frontend Developers are professionals who design and build the user-facing parts of websites and web applications. They use technologies like HTML, CSS, and JavaScript to create interactive and visually appealing interfaces that users interact with directly in their browsers. Frontend Developers work closely with designers and backend developers to ensure a seamless and responsive user experience across different devices and platforms. Their role often includes optimizing website performance, ensuring accessibility, and maintaining code quality.

What is the difference between Frontend Developer vs Web Designer?

AspectFrontend DeveloperWeb Designer
Primary FocusBuilding and coding website interfaces using HTML, CSS, JavaScriptDesigning visual layout, user experience, and aesthetics
Skills & CertificationsHTML, CSS, JavaScript, frameworks, coding skillsDesign tools (Photoshop, Sketch), UX/UI principles
Work EnvironmentCollaborates with developers and backend teams in tech settingsWorks with clients, marketing teams, and creative departments
Industry UsageWeb development companies, tech firms, startupsDesign agencies, marketing firms, freelance projects

While both roles contribute to website creation, a Frontend Developer focuses on coding and implementing interactive features, whereas a Web Designer emphasizes visual design and user experience. Understanding these differences helps in choosing the right career path or job search focus.

How do Frontend Developers typically collaborate with designers and backend teams during a project?

Frontend Developers regularly work closely with UX/UI designers to ensure that visual elements are accurately translated into interactive web pages and applications. They also coordinate with backend developers to integrate APIs and manage data flow between the server and the user interface. Regular meetings, code reviews, and collaborative tools like version control systems help streamline communication and maintain consistency across the project. This teamwork is essential to deliver a cohesive and high-performing end product.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Frontend Developer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Frontend Developer, you need a solid grasp of HTML, CSS, JavaScript, and modern frameworks like React or Angular, often supported by a deg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with version control systems (e.g., Git), responsive design tools, and web performance optimization techniques is typically required. Creativity, attention to detail, and strong problem-solving abilities help you build intuitive, user-friendly interfaces and collaborate effectively with design and backend teams. These skills and qualities are crucial for delivering high-quality, interactive web applications that meet user and business needs.

Qualifications:

Required:

  • Ability to obtain and maintain a Secret security clearance
  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Software Engineering, or a related technical discipline
  • 7+ years of professional software development experience with a strong focus on frontend engineering
  • Strong proficiency in Angular (2+) is required, including building and maintaining large-scale enterprise applications
  • Proven experience developing and supporting enterprise-grade web applications in complex environments (required)
  • Expertise in TypeScript and modern JavaScript (ES6+)
  • Strong experience with HTML5, CSS3/SASS, and responsive, accessible web design
  • Experience with state management and reactive programming (RxJS, NgRx, or similar)
  • Experience integrating frontend applications with RESTful and/or GraphQL APIs
  • Hands-on experience with Git-based source control (GitHub or similar)
  • 4+ years' experience working in Agile environments using tools such as Jira and Confluence
  • Proven ability to lead frontend development efforts, including owning stories, driving implementation, and guiding junior developers
  • Strong understanding of scalable, maintainable frontend architecture for enterprise systems
  • Experience with CI/CD pipelines and automated build/deployment processes
  • Strong collaboration skills working with cross-functional teams (backend, DevOps, product)
  • Local to Los Angeles area (or willing to relocate)

Desired:

  • Experience with React or other modern frameworks (secondary to Angular)
  • Familiarity with data visualization libraries such as D3.js
  • Experience developing secure applications for government or regulated industries
  • Knowledge of secure development best practices and compliance requirements
  • Experience optimizing performance for high-traffic, data-intensive applications
  • Familiarity with Docker, Kubernetes, or other containerization tools
  • Swift / iOS development experience is a plus
  • Experience integrating AI/ML or LLM-driven features into frontend applications
  • Strong documentation skills and adherence to coding standards and UI best practices
